A car crash victim was declared dead by two paramedics, who then left the scene, leaving him trapped in the wreckage—only for other emergency responders to find the man alive more than an hour later.
The 30-year-old, who crashed his Porsche early Sunday in Melbourne, Australia, was being loaded into a coroner's van when it was noticed that he still had a faint pulse.
While the victim remains in critical condition in a Melbourne hospital, ambulance chiefs pledged to hold an internal inquiry to discover how the extraordinary mistake occurred.
